web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Classes | Macros | Functions
test_iSACfixfloat.c File Reference
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include "isac.h"
#include "isacfix.h"
#include "webrtc/base/format_macros.h"
#include <time.h>

Classes

struct  BottleNeckModel
 

Macros

#define MAX_FRAMESAMPLES   960
 
#define FRAMESAMPLES_10ms   160
 
#define FS   16000
 
#define CLOCKS_PER_SEC   1000
 

Functions

int readframe (int16_t *data, FILE *inp, int length)
 
void get_arrival_time (int current_framesamples, size_t packet_size, int bottleneck, BottleNeckModel *BN_data)
 
int main (int argc, char *argv[])
 

Macro Definition Documentation

◆ CLOCKS_PER_SEC

#define CLOCKS_PER_SEC   1000

◆ FRAMESAMPLES_10ms

#define FRAMESAMPLES_10ms   160

◆ FS

#define FS   16000

◆ MAX_FRAMESAMPLES

#define MAX_FRAMESAMPLES   960

Function Documentation

◆ get_arrival_time()

void get_arrival_time ( int  current_framesamples,
size_t  packet_size,
int  bottleneck,
BottleNeckModel BN_data 
)

◆ main()

int main ( int  argc,
char *  argv[] 
)

◆ readframe()

int readframe ( int16_t data,
FILE *  inp,
int  length 
)